It is recommended that a wildlife rehabilitator have a degree in ecology or biology, with a curriculum that includes subjects like animal behaviour, ornithology, ecology, mammalogy and related wildlife and/or environmental studies. 116pp. The Wildlife Rescue and Rehabilitation course will focus on the fundamentals of wildlife rehabilitation, and that can be applied to all species. Applicants must be at least 18 years old, have passed a state examination on wildlife rehabilitation, complete an application, provide evidence of a licensed wildlife rehabilitator willing to mentor them, provide evidence of a veterinarian willing to assist them and maintain approved facilities. A licence is not currently required to rehabilitate animals, but future legislation may change this. Licences are required for some activities, such as the keeping and release of grey squirrels or certain birds of prey. Our ultimate aim is the successful release of all wild animals back to the wild, ideally back to the area where they were found where possible (if known). Wildlife rehabilitation is the treatment and care of a sick, injured or orphaned wild animal and its preparation for release to a successful life back in the wild.
